noun
- information, especially of a biased or misleading nature, used to promote or publicize a particular political cause or point of view
Examples
- The government used propaganda to gain support for the war.
- Students learned to identify propaganda techniques in advertisements.
- The poster was clearly propaganda designed to influence voters.
- During wartime, both sides spread propaganda about their enemies.
- The documentary exposed how propaganda was used to manipulate public opinion.
- She could recognize propaganda because of its emotional appeals and lack of evidence.
